Transaction e76f98606fb60f694f766804324d068bd317a68ee4a6fbe68fdbbf03fbabb293

5 Input
2 Outputs
  • e76f98606fb60f694f766804324d068bd317a68ee4a6fbe68fdbbf03fbabb293:0
  • value  781760
    address  15QvWGyHhQdRFw11UHWEmZ3tEKHuFWbEKF
  • e76f98606fb60f694f766804324d068bd317a68ee4a6fbe68fdbbf03fbabb293:1
  • value  41259000
    address  3KwMKizm5xJAqnk7aP9f3GwPtgenkg5MDJ